The final bill for septic work depends on a few practical details. First, the size of your tank and how long it has been since the last pump-out matter; older or neglected systems often require more labor to clear. Accessibility also plays a role, as tanks buried deep or under landscaping take longer to reach. If you have an emergency blockage or require repairs to baffles or risers, those add to the total. Cleaning your septic tank involves removing the accumulated solid waste and sludge that builds up over time. This process is essential to ensure that solids do not escape into your drain field, which could lead to expensive repairs. Summer often means more houseguests and increased water usage, which puts a heavier load on your septic system. With more laundry and showers, solids can accumulate faster than usual. Keep an eye on your lawn for soggy patches or unusually lush grass, which can be signs of a stressed system. A quick mid-season check helps ensure everything flows smoothly.
A septic tank is an underground wastewater treatment structure. Its main purpose is to collect all the wastewater from your home or business. It then separates solids and sludge from the liquids, allowing for partial treatment before the liquid effluent is discharged to a drain field. This process prevents raw sewage from polluting the environment.

With proper maintenance, a septic tank can last for decades, often 20 to 30 years or even longer. Regular pumping and inspections are key to extending its lifespan. Neglecting maintenance can significantly shorten its life, leading to costly replacements. Think of it like any important home system; care makes a big difference.
Septic tanks typically need to be emptied, or pumped, every 3 to 5 years. This frequency depends on the size of your tank and the amount of wastewater your household generates. Overloading the tank speeds up the buildup of solids. Consistent pumping prevents system failures and costly repairs.
